Rivers of Steel: Carrie Blast Furnaces National Historic Landmark
Located at 801 Carrie Furnace Boulevard in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, the Rivers of Steel: Carrie Blast Furnaces National Historic Landmark is a must-visit tourist attraction and travel agency. These blast furnaces are a reminder of Pittsburgh's steel industry dominance in the 20th century, standing at 92 feet tall and constructed with thick steel plate and refractory brick. These furnaces are rare examples of pre-World War II iron-making technology and are the only non-operative blast furnaces in the region that remain. Visitors can explore this historic site through various tours, workshops, exhibitions, and events, including guided tours that highlight the iron-making technology and the culture of the workers. The site has also become a creative muse for many, with workshops such as graffiti art, metal casting, and blacksmithing programs available for all skill levels.
